Job Description
The Skills, Training and Transitions Officer will be responsible for leading the operational approach to skills training and transitions in a school setting. The role will act under the direction of the Head of Campus and will contribute to the life of the school. Key duties include working within the Four Principles framework, being an integral member of the Senior Learning Hub team, attending reflective practice and staff meetings, organizing industry visits, promoting career expos and connection days, presenting information at community circle, and supporting the end-of-year graduation process.
Required Skills and Qualifications
To be successful in this role, applicants should have:
* a strong understanding of and commitment to the values of a Catholic educational system of schools in the Edmund Rice tradition;
* proven senior leadership experience with strong organizational, administrative, communication, and leadership skills;
* tertiary qualifications in teaching or social work or youth work (or similar);
* a current Working with Children Check;
* demonstrated expertise in skills training and transitions field, including vocational education and training;
* effective organizational skills to utilize resources, staff, and operations to meet the needs of the School Improvement Plan;
